In computer science, an interpreter is a computer program that directly executes instructions written in a programming or scripting language, without requiring them previously to have been compiled into a machine language program. An interpreter generally uses one of the following strategies for … See more Interpreters were used as early as 1952 to ease programming within the limitations of computers at the time (e.g. a shortage of program storage space, or no native support for floating point numbers). WebBut a poor compiler will produce clunky, inefficient, bloated machine code whilst the better one produces efficient, tightly-coded, fast machine code that takes advantage of all the special features of the target CPU and makes minimum use of memory. Making software run faster or in less memory is called ' code optimisation '.
